IxiCash Supply
10,140,109,854 IXI
Active DLT Nodes
214
Estimated Hashrate
9,982,655 h/s

Total Transactions
92,620,349
24h Transactions
4,484
Average transactions per Day
22,803

Blocks

Height Hash Added Txs